Race and Ethnicity in Latin America

Race and Ethnicity in Latin America

1st Edition

By Jorge I Dominguez
March 01, 1994

First Published in 1994. In nearly all racially and ethnically heterogeneous societies, there is overt national conflict among parties and social movements organized on the basis of race and ethnicity. Such conflict has been much less evident in Latin America. Scholars have pondered the nature of ...

Economic Strategies and Policies in Latin America

Economic Strategies and Policies in Latin America

1st Edition

By Jorge I Dominguez
February 01, 1994

Economists have debated Latin America’s economic strategies at two moments since the second world war. The first debate, often characterized as between monetarists and structuralists, flourished from the late 1950s to the early 1970s. It focused on the strengths and weaknesses of a strategy of ...
